    NPCs Don't Die When HP Reaches Zero

    I'm not sure if I'm missing something or if this is a bug in the functionality, but I've noticed that when running encounters my NPC's and monsters don't acquire the "dead" effect when their HP reaches 0. Instead they get the effects "unconscious" and "stable". I have the option for auto-stabilizing NPC's disabled in the settings, so I'm not sure why it's doing this. I would very much prefer that my bad guys just be dead when they die. Does anyone know how I can fix it?

    Right. So, there is a "Nonlethal" modifier under the Modifiers menus (shown at the top of the screen as the "+/-" icon), which should, in theory, create the exact effect that I'm seeing. The problem is that I'm not using it and that modifier is not active when this is happening in my game. I've checked. For some reason, FG is randomly making PC attacks nonlethal and I can't figure out why.

    OK... Actually, I've figure out that this seems to only happen when the killing blow is a critical hit. For some reason any time I roll critical damage it is applying as nonlethal. I'll report this in the "Bugs" topic.
